How they compare
Poland currently reports 7,890 US dollars, PPP converted against 829.05 US dollars, PPP converted in Slovenia, a difference of 7,061 US dollars, PPP converted.
That makes Poland's figure about 9.5 times Slovenia's.
Across all 27 years both countries report, Poland has been ahead every year.
Poland ranks 6th and Slovenia ranks 8th of 12 countries.
Poland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Poland | Slovenia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 2,427 US dollars, PPP converted | 264 US dollars, PPP converted | 2,163 US dollars, PPP converted | Poland |
| 2000s | 2,713 US dollars, PPP converted | 392.63 US dollars, PPP converted | 2,320 US dollars, PPP converted | Poland |
| 2010s | 4,313 US dollars, PPP converted | 379.26 US dollars, PPP converted | 3,934 US dollars, PPP converted | Poland |
| 2020s | 7,025 US dollars, PPP converted | 621.44 US dollars, PPP converted | 6,404 US dollars, PPP converted | Poland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
